Objection Punctuation: No Conjunction — Period After Each Reason

The Period

Rulebase Summary

When there is no coordinate conjunction between any of the objection reasons, use a period after each separate objection, whether it is a complete sentence or a fragment, before going on to the next.

BGGP Period.8 · p.70

Examples

MS. CHEN: Objection, compound, vague, overbroad.

MS. CHEN: Objection. Compound. Vague. Overbroad.

No conjunctions — treat each reason as its own sentence.

MR. TORRES: Objection, relevance, hearsay, speculation.

MR. TORRES: Objection. Relevance. Hearsay. Speculation.

No conjunctions between reasons — period after each one.
